> > Anyone here into GIS?
> > I'm searching for up-to-date (!), free (!), detailed and complete
> > (world) vector data of administrative country borders,
> > possibly also state/river/lake data.
> > Searching through heaps of bullshit edu/gov/mil sites, the
> > most appropriate match i found would be the "Digital Chart of
> > the World", or VMAP0 (from nga.mil <http://nga.mil>), a gigabyte-sized,
> quite
> > detailed collection of more or less everything. The problem
> > is that the VPF format they use is rather sophisticated and
> > complicated, and there are no free tools to convert it into a
> > simpler format such as SHP (there is one, MICRODEM, but it
> > refuses to work on my machine). I'd much prefer a less
> > sophisticated SHP format (i found numerous SHP resources, but
> > most of them are either incomplete, outdated or payware).
> > The alternative would be to sit down a few months and grok
> > VPF to write a VPF2SHP converter, extracting the data
> > relevant for me, but i wouldn't really want to do that ;) Anyone?
